Wezi has sixty-three $5-bills to the bank to exchange them for $20-bills. How many $20-bills does Wezi get? Is there money left

over? explain

Answer:

A. Wezi will get fifteen (15) $20-bills.

B. There will be $15 left.

Step-by-step explanation:

A. We have been given that Wezi has sixty-three $5 bills.

Let us find the total amount of money that Wezi has by multiplying 63 by 5.

\text{Total amount of money Wezi has}=63\times\$5

\text{Total amount of money Wezi has}=\$315

Therefore, Wezi has $315.

Since Wezi wants to exchange her total money of $5 bills with $20 bills, so let us divide total amount of money by 20.

\text{The number of \$20 bills}=\frac{\$315}{\$20}

\text{The number of \$20 bills}=15.75

Since we cannot 0.75 of a $20 bill, so Wezi will get 15 $20-bills.

We can see that 315 is not completely divisible by 20, so let us subtract greatest multiple of 20 from 315.

We can see 15\times 20=300, so upon subtracting 300 from 315 we will get,

\$315-\$300=\$15

Therefore, there will be $15 left.

The cost function for a certain company is C = 20x + 700 and the revenue is given by R = 100x − 0.5x2. Recall that profit is rev
Brilliant_brown [7]

Answer:

x = 20

x = 140

Step-by-step explanation:

Find the equation for profit P

P = R - C

Substitute the equations for R and C then simplify.

P = 100x − 0.5x² - (20x + 700)

P = -0.5x² + 80x - 700

Find the values of x when profit is $700

P = -0.5x² + 80x - 700

700 = -0.5x² + 80x - 700

0 = -0.5x² + 80x - 1400

This is in the standard form 0 = ax² + bx + c

Use the quadratic formula to find values of x

x = \frac{-b±\sqrt{b^{2}-4ac}  }{2a}

(Ignore Â)

Substitute a b and c.

a = -0.5

b = 80

c = -1400

x = \frac{-(80)±\sqrt{80^{2}-4(-0.5)(-1400)}  }{2(-0.5)}

x = \frac{-80±60}{-1}

Split the formula at the ± so that there are two to get the two x values.

x = \frac{-80+60}{-1}

x = \frac{-80-60}{-1}

x = 20

x = 140

The profit will be $700 when x is 20 or when x is 140.
